Our rural, hilly terrain and harsh winters lead to frequent issues with suspension components, brakes, and exhaust systems. Additionally, the heavy use of road salt accelerates rust and corrosion, making undercarriage inspections and regular washes crucial for vehicle longevity in Westmoreland.

Pricing is competitive with the wider Keene area, but labor rates may vary. For example, a standard brake job can range from $300-$600 per axle, while exhaust repairs depend heavily on rust severity. Always request a detailed written estimate from a local shop before authorizing work.
